U+1035 "ဵ" Myanmar Vowel Sign E Above Unicode Character
Unicode Version 17.0
ဵ
U+1035 "ဵ" Myanmar Vowel Sign E Above is a combining diacritical mark used in the Myanmar script to represent the vowel sound "e" positioned above the consonant it modifies. This character is integral to the orthography of the Burmese language, where it appears as a small hook or curve placed atop a base consonant letter, altering its inherent vowel to produce the short or long "e" sound depending on context. It typically combines with other vowel signs or letters to form syllables in written Burmese, and its correct rendering requires a font that supports complex text layout due to Myanmar script's intricate stacking and positioning rules.
General Properties
| Code Point | U+1035 |
| Version Added | 5.1 |
| Name | Myanmar Vowel Sign E Above |
| Block | Myanmar |
| General Category | Nonspacing Mark |
| Canonical Combining Class | Not Reordered |
| Bidirectional Class | Nonspacing Mark |
